Job Description

The role will be the key Finance Business Partner across Amazon Logistics (AMZL) Last Mile. Amazon's "Last Mile” delivery service is responsible for delivering packages (and smiles) to households/businesses across Australia. Our finance team closely partners to support this rapidly expanding business while building a portfolio of delivery stations, vehicles, and technology to deliver customers' packages on time - often next day, sometimes faster. We augment our traditional "deliver by van" with other models including Amazon Flex (gig economy drivers) and more - all designed to deliver smiles to our customers.Key job responsibilities- Partner with Last Mile business streams, Operations, Supply Chain and Customer Excellence teams to implement cost-saving initiatives and process improvements- Develop and publish regular financial reports highlighting key performance indicators and regular business metrics- Perform weekly/monthly controllership activities alongside variance analysis versus' plan and forecast- Ad hoc strategic analysis to drive program expansion, balancing delivery speed initiatives with cost efficiency
